The Golden State Warriors recently hired Mike Dunleavy Jr. as general manager, and he’s wasting little time putting his mark on the team.
According to ESPN’s NBA insider Adrian Wojnarowski, the Golden State Warriors are sending guard Jordan Poole in a package to the Washington Wizards in exchange for former NBA All-Pro point guard Chris Paul.
Wojnarowski clarified in a following tweet that the Warriors sent a 2030 protected first-round and a 2027 second-rounder to the Wizards as part of the package for Paul.

Paul played collegiately with the Wake Forest Demon Deacons. He entered the NBA in 2005 when the then-New Orleans Hornets selected Paul with the fourth overall pick of the draft.
Paul made stops with the Los Angeles Clippers, Houston Rockets, Oklahoma City Thunder, and Phoenix Suns before he got traded to the Wizards earlier this month.
Poole played collegiately with the Michigan Wolverines. The Golden State Warriors selected him with the 28th overall pick in the 2019 NBA Draft. Poole spent time with the Santa Cruz Warriors, Golden State’s G-League affiliate, until 2021.
Warriors forward Draymond Greene infamously knocked out Poole during a practice scrimmage last season, possibly foretelling his exit from the storied franchise.
